🏡 What Buyers Should Know
1. Preparation Matters More Than Ever
✔ Pre-approval is essential
✔ Buyers who understand their budget are winning deals
✔ Strong offers are about terms, not just price
2. Competition Still Exists—Selectively
Entry-level and well-priced homes often receive multiple offers
Overpriced or poorly presented listings sit longer
Smart buyers focus on value, not hype.
3. Negotiation Opportunities Are Back
Compared to recent years:
✔ Seller concessions are more common
✔ Inspection negotiations are more realistic
✔ Flexibility can work in your favor
Patience and strategy matter.
🏠 What Sellers Should Know
1. Pricing Correctly Is Critical
The days of “name your price” are gone.
Overpricing leads to longer days on market
Buyers are more price-sensitive
First impressions online matter more than ever
Correct pricing still drives faster sales.
2. Presentation Is Non-Negotiable
Homes that sell fastest:
✔ Are clean and staged
✔ Have professional photos
✔ Are easy to show
Presentation often determines final sale price.
3. Buyers Are More Selective
Today’s buyers:
Compare homes carefully
Factor in repairs and future costs
Walk away from homes that feel overpriced
Condition and transparency matter.
📈 Interest Rates & Affordability
Rates impact monthly payments more than home price alone
Small rate changes can significantly affect buying power
Many buyers are adjusting expectations rather than exiting the market
Affordability—not demand—is the main driver right now.
